I made this as a wedding gift for a cousin back in the mid 90s. It's made using ordering samples and each block finished out at 2". You can tell it's an early piece by looking at the borders. See how "friendly" they are? I didn't measure the border pieces, just sewed them on and then trimmed them to size. Now I know better and can sometimes even get borders that lay flat and don't wave.
